Greg Stark <gsstark@mit.edu> writes:

> So i tried this:
> 
> (nnspool "cache"
>          (nnspool-spool-directory "/mit/gsstark/News/cache")
>          (nnspool-nov-directory "/mit/gsstark/News/cache")
>          (nnspool-lib-dir "/mit/gsstark/News/cache")
>          (nnspool-active-file "/mit/gsstark/News/active"))

I think the last should be "/mit/gsstark/News/cache/active".

> I get this:
> Couldn't request list: Opened server cache using directory /mit/gsstark/News/cache
> 
> This isn't really the most useful error message, 

Not very, no.  0.96 should give better errors here.  I have a feeling
that quite a lot of the backend functions give bogus error messages.
Could y'all let me know when that happens so I can fix that?
